Transaction 30a38e138415043ce88ed3486e6b72bdb43f6b6827543c01ef5c2f6dd70b6e96
1 Input
1 Output
-
30a38e138415043ce88ed3486e6b72bdb43f6b6827543c01ef5c2f6dd70b6e96:0
- value
- 101026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a20c836f3b1181a494f3579a1e3691feebc8137 OP_EQUAL
- address
- 3HCa4tpu7SuBA4gM69Q758yNr2dvVaxaLg